Course Details

• Geospatial Data Overview
• Data Acquisition Technologies (Remote Sensing, GNSS, LiDAR)
• Geospatial Data Formats and Standards (GIS, Shapefiles, KML, GeoJSON)
• Geospatial Data Processing and Analysis (Spatial Analysis, Network Analysis, Hydrological Modeling)
• Geospatial Data Visualization and Cartography (Map Projections, Symbology, Data Styling)
• Geospatial Data Management (Data Versioning, Databases, Data Archiving)
• Geospatial Data Integration (Web Mapping, Web GIS, OGC Standards)
• Geospatial Data Security and Privacy (Metadata, Access Control, Data Encryption)
• Geospatial Data Ethics and Legal Issues (Data Ownership, Licensing, Copyright)
